Weather in Virār in October

India · 20-year averages, October

A good month. October is a solid month to be in Virār. Highs average 29.7 °C, lows 26.6 °C, and rain falls on 10 days — nothing in the month is working against you.

October ranks 8 of 12 in Virār: past the worst of the year but short of January, which is the month to book if the dates are open.

Rain on 10 days, 2 of them heavy. Enough to need a plan B, not enough to need a plan around it. Pack for 29.7 °C days and 26.6 °C nights; the spread matters more here than any single number.

What the averages hide

Averages flatten a month, and this one hides a few things: 13 days top 30 °C — hot spells arrive, but they break; the day barely swings — 3.1 °C between the overnight low and the afternoon high. Across the twenty years measured, the hottest October day reached 32.8 °C and the coldest night fell to 22.1 °C, and the wettest single day dropped 60 mm — roughly 86% of the month's rain in one day.

October is moderately variable: 2 mm in the driest year against 173 mm in the wettest, around an average of 70 mm. Roughly two Octobers in three land near that average, and the third does something else entirely.

Wind is light at 11.3 km/h, so the temperature on the page is close to the temperature on your skin, and humidity is unremarkable at 74%.

How October sits in the year

Temperatures hold steady either side: 28.2 °C in September, 29.7 here, 29.2 in November. Nothing about the timing within the month matters much. Rain is the thing that moves: November brings 8 days less of it, so pushing the dates later buys drier weather.

Daylight in October

11.7 hours of daylight, losing 0.5 hours across the month. That is between Virār's extremes of 13.3 and 11 hours, so days are long enough not to constrain the plan.

Sea temperature

The sea sits at about 29.2 °C in October — warm enough that the water offers no relief from the heat. The sea peaks at 29.7 °C in June and bottoms out at 25.3 °C — water lags the air by a month or two, which is why the best swimming often comes after the best weather.

October in Virār versus nearby

If Virār is one option among several, the nearby comparison is worth making. Mumbai is the weaker option in October — 2.2 °C warmer, 1 day more rain. Nashik is close enough to be a coin toss — within a degree on temperature, 1 day less rain.

So: October is a compromise. January is 31 points better and is what Virār is actually like at its best — worth moving the trip for if that is possible, and worth adjusting expectations for if it is not.
